Latest Patents

Okada's latest patents include a semiconductor device that features a first substrate with multiple first through-holes. This device incorporates a plurality of first electrodes adjacent to these through-holes, as well as second electrodes that face the first electrodes. Additionally, a second substrate is positioned to face the first substrate, containing second through-holes that align with the first. This design ensures electrical connectivity between the second substrate and the second electrodes. Another patent describes a semiconductor device that includes a semiconductor chip with a region containing through holes, a substrate with a larger first opening, and a spacer positioned between the chip and the substrate.
